What are the formulas for calculating the perimeter and area of a parallelogram?

  1. Area = a x b; Perimeter = 2(a + b)

  2. Perimeter = a x b; Area = 2a + 2b

  3. Perimeter = 2a + 2b; Area = a x h

  4. Area = a + b; Perimeter = a x h

The correct answer is: Perimeter = 2a + 2b; Area = a x h

The choice regarding the formulas for calculating the perimeter and area of a parallelogram is accurate because it correctly identifies the relationships between the dimensions of a parallelogram. For the area of a parallelogram, the formula "Area = a x h" is appropriate, where "a" represents the length of the base, and "h" represents the height. The height is perpendicular to the base and is essential for determining the area, which is the space contained within the shape.
